We went to On The Border on Black Friday after alot of shopping. We were at bit skeptical since the place was not too busy but we are happy we went. My husband had the Birria Tacos and I had the Beef Fajitas. We both were happy with our meals. It was fulfilling but not too much food. His tacos were moist and, thankfully, not overly greasy. I have a high expectation for beef Fajitas since not only are they pricy but I can make them at home. These where definitely worth the price. They came medium rare and were well seasoned. They carried a smoky flavor and were perfect for tacos. I also appreciate there was a decent serving size and most establishments skimp on beef Fajitas. Definitely will be going back.

Oh not to mention the service. Our waiter was kind and attentive. I beleive the manager was present and attentive as well. We took come a Tres Leches cake (I am also particular). It wasnt the best ever, but it was a good tasty reminder of home 😋❤️. It wasnt too sweet either.
